No. 14 Group RAF

No. 14 Group RAF was first formed on 1 April 1918 by the redesignation of Milford Haven Anti-Submarine Group. On 8 May it was transferred to Midland Area, and it was disbanded on 19 May 1919.

Its second incarnation was part of the wartime expansion of the Royal Air Force. On 20 January 1940 No. 60 Wing in the British Expeditionary Force was raised to Group level as No. 14 Group. The Group was then disbanded on 22 June. However a few days later it was reformed in Fighter Command to provide cover for Scotland. The Group was disbanded on 15 July 1943.
